package main import ( "testing" "github.com/DeBrosOfficial/network/pkg/turn" "gopkg.in/yaml.v3" ) // TestDecodeTURNConfig_acceptsSpawnerOutput is the regression guard for the // feat-124 crash: the namespace spawner writes the TURN config via // yaml.Marshal(turn.Config), and the TURN binary parses it with a STRICT // decoder. If turn.Config gains a yaml field the parser doesn't know, strict // decode rejects it and TURN crash-loops at startup. This pins that the // spawner's exact output round-trips through the parser, including the stealth // fields. func TestDecodeTURNConfig_acceptsSpawnerOutput(t *testing.T) { src := turn.Config{ ListenAddr: "0.0.0.0:3478", TURNSListenAddr: "0.0.0.0:5349", PublicIP: "203.0.113.7", Realm: "orama-devnet.network", AuthSecret: "secret", RelayPortStart: 49152, RelayPortEnd: 49951, Namespace: "anchat-test", TLSCertPath: "/x/turn-cert.pem", TLSKeyPath: "/x/turn-key.pem", StealthDomain: "cdn-3259254d4d3e.orama-devnet.network", TLSStealthCertPath: "/var/lib/caddy/caddy/certificates/.../wildcard_.orama-devnet.network.crt", TLSStealthKeyPath: "/var/lib/caddy/caddy/certificates/.../wildcard_.orama-devnet.network.key", } data, err := yaml.Marshal(src) if err != nil { t.Fatalf("marshal: %v", err) } got, err := decodeTURNConfig(data) if err != nil { t.Fatalf("strict decode of spawner output failed — TURN would crash-loop at startup: %v\n---\n%s", err, data) } if got.StealthDomain != src.StealthDomain || got.TLSStealthCertPath != src.TLSStealthCertPath || got.TLSStealthKeyPath != src.TLSStealthKeyPath { t.Errorf("stealth fields did not round-trip: got %+v", got) } if got.AuthSecret != src.AuthSecret || got.TURNSListenAddr != src.TURNSListenAddr { t.Errorf("core fields did not round-trip: got %+v", got) } } // TestDecodeTURNConfig_rejectsUnknownField confirms the strict decoder still // rejects genuinely-unknown keys (so the contract above is meaningful). func TestDecodeTURNConfig_rejectsUnknownField(t *testing.T) { if _, err := decodeTURNConfig([]byte("listen_addr: \"0.0.0.0:3478\"\nbogus_field: 1\n")); err == nil { t.Fatal("expected strict decode to reject an unknown field") } }
